HOW TO WINTERIZE HIBISCUS PLANTS
Watering Tips for Care for Hibiscus in the Winter. The first thing to remember about hibiscus winter care is that hibiscus in the winter will need less water than it does in the summer. While watering is essential to your year-round care for hibiscus, in the winter, you should only water the plant when the soil is dry to the touch.
